These programs build images using mathematical formulas to generate simple shapes between points instead of pixels.Ī vector graphic is generated by creating points (or nodes) and joining these together with lines (known as paths) to build shapes. Pros and cons of vector and raster images It's also worth noting that while a vector graphic can be easily converted to a raster - the raster image is "locked in" at the resolution specified when it was converted - a raster image can't generally be converted to vector, though some tools can convert simple raster images to vector in a limited way. When enlarged, you'll easily see the difference between vectors and rasters. This means that a raster image will lose sharpness if you display or print it larger than it was intended - you've no doubt seen this when zooming in on a detail in a JPG image. If you could inspect the code contained in a raster image file, you would see that it tells the computer exactly which color to place in each pixel. This means that artists and designers don't need to worry about what size their image will be printed at, because it'll always look good.Ī raster image, on the other hand, is purpose-made for a certain resolution, and the image is literally defined as a grid. You can increase a vector image's size by 1000 percent, and it would look exactly the same - no blurriness or washed out colors. In a nutshell, vector graphics' mathematical nature makes them "resolution independent," or able to keep the same quality at any size. But what does that really mean for the user?
